- Cost Reports: One or more Cost Reports
- Dashboards: A specific dashboard
- Slack: You can send a notification to one or more public or private channels in a Slack workspace (for Cost Reports only).
- Microsoft Teams: You can send a notification to one or more public or private channels in a Microsoft Teams account (for Cost Reports only).
- Email: You can send a notification to one or more email addresses (for both Cost Reports and Dashboards).
You can create either a Slack integration or a Microsoft Teams integration, but not both.
Dashboard notifications can only be sent via email. Cost Reports can be sent via email, Slack, or Microsoft Teams.
Report Notifications vs. Cost Anomaly Alerts vs. Cost Alerts
Vantage provides multiple ways to keep you informed about your cloud spend. Report Notifications offer scheduled digests of Cost Reports and Dashboards and are sent on a recurring basis. Cost Anomaly Alerts are sent once per day when costs exceed an anomaly threshold, based on a Vantage machine learning model. In contrast, Cost Alerts allow you to define custom thresholds for specific reports. They are triggered when your cost data meets the conditions you’ve set.Set Up Slack Integration

To create Cost Report Notifications, follow the steps below. If you want to send notifications via Slack or Microsoft Teams, ensure you have set up the appropriate integration first. If you instead want to create an email notification, the email report will contain a list of all of your views and a point-in-time cost for each view. Note that data is delayed two days to ensure completeness.Click to view example email notification

1
Navigate to the Notifications screen.
2
Click New Notification in the top right corner.
3
Select Report Notification.
4
Enter a Title for the report.
5
If you want to send the report as an email, select the emails for any current Vantage users you want to receive the report.
6
Optionally, select if you want to include a PDF of the chart as an email attachment. PDF exports are not available for Slack or Teams notifications.
See the Cost Report Exports docs for more information about PDF exports.
7
Depending on which integration you’ve enabled, a Slack Channels or Microsoft Teams Channels field is displayed. Select the channels you want to send the notification to. You can add as many channels as you want, and they will all receive the notification.
8
Select a report from the dropdown list, then select a Frequency (e.g., daily, weekly, or monthly).
Monthly notifications will be sent on the second of the month. Weekly notifications will be sent on Mondays.
9
For Change, select Dollars or Percentage.
10
Click Save.
Set Up Dashboard Notifications
Report Notifications can also be configured for dashboards. Dashboard notifications provide scheduled digests of a dashboard and can only be sent via email.1
Navigate to the Notifications screen.
2
Click New Notification in the top right corner.
3
Select Dashboard Notification.
4
Enter a Title for the dashboard notification.
5
Select the emails for any current Vantage users you want to receive the notification.
6
Select a dashboard from the dropdown list.
7
Select a Frequency (e.g., daily, weekly, or monthly).
Monthly notifications will be sent on the second of the month. Weekly notifications will be sent on Mondays.
8
Click Save.
